bigbadbadge Posted June 6, 2022 Author Share Posted June 6, 2022 Hi all Some minor progress on the Tigermoth. Control horns cut off the rudder and added to the area directly under the first cockpit entrance on each side. I cut a slot in the rudder and added new control horns which are longer due to the anti spin strakes other wise the cable run would not be straight. Wing strut areas smoothed out, Airfix have done the same with the tops of the fuselage struts, but the good news there is that this is actually prototypical, bonus Some PE on the underside, I have modified the bit in the middle and just have to add sides to the vent, stoll quite a lot to do under there yet Thanks for looking Chris 9 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
